Post 19 December

Tableau Mastery: How to Create Interactive and Eye-Catching Data Visualizations

Understanding Tableau Basics

Before diving into complex visualizations, it’s crucial to understand Tableau’s foundational elements.

Workbooks and Sheets Tableau operates with workbooks containing multiple sheets. Each sheet can be a different type of visualization or dashboard.

Data Connections Tableau connects to various data sources, including spreadsheets, databases, and cloud services. Ensure your data is clean and well-organized before importing it.

Dimensions and Measures Dimensions are qualitative data (e.g., product names), while measures are quantitative (e.g., sales numbers). Understanding this distinction helps in choosing the right type of visualization.

Designing Interactive Dashboards

Creating interactive dashboards can significantly enhance user engagement. Here’s how to design them effectively.

Use Filters and Parameters Filters allow users to view specific segments of data, while parameters enable them to control various aspects of the visualization (e.g., time periods, categories).

Add Action Filters Actions such as filter actions and highlight actions can make your dashboard more interactive. For instance, clicking on a bar in a bar chart can filter a related map.

Incorporate Tooltips Tooltips provide additional information when users hover over data points. Customize tooltips to deliver relevant insights without cluttering the visualization.

Choosing the Right Visualization Type

The choice of visualization greatly impacts how data is perceived. Here are some popular types and their uses.

Bar Charts Ideal for comparing quantities across categories. Use stacked bars to show sub-category breakdowns.

Line Charts Perfect for showing trends over time. Use them to display changes and forecast future values.

Pie Charts Best for illustrating proportions. Limit the number of slices to avoid clutter.

Heat Maps Useful for showing data density and patterns. They help identify trends and anomalies across different variables.

Scatter Plots Excellent for showing relationships between two variables. Use trend lines to highlight correlations.

Applying Effective Design Principles

Aesthetics play a crucial role in data visualization. Follow these principles to enhance your designs.

Choose a Clean Color Palette Use contrasting colors to differentiate data series but avoid overwhelming the viewer with too many colors.

Maintain Consistency Keep font styles, colors, and sizes consistent throughout your dashboard for a cohesive look.

Optimize for Readability Ensure that text labels are legible and that visualizations are not overcrowded. Use whitespace effectively to separate different elements.

Leveraging Advanced Features

Tableau offers advanced features to further enhance your visualizations.

Calculated Fields Create custom metrics and dimensions by defining calculations within Tableau. This can help in deriving new insights from your data.

Sets and Groups Use sets to create dynamic subsets of your data and groups to combine similar categories. This helps in managing and analyzing complex datasets.

Table Calculations Apply calculations to data at the table level. This feature is useful for running totals, moving averages, and more.

Optimizing Performance

To ensure that your visualizations perform efficiently.

Optimize Data Sources Use extracts instead of live connections when possible, as they are faster and reduce the load on the database.

Minimize Complex Calculations Avoid complex calculations in visualizations that can slow down performance. Pre-calculate values where feasible.

Use Efficient Data Structures Organize your data in a way that minimizes unnecessary joins and aggregations.

Mastering Tableau involves more than just understanding its features; it requires a thoughtful approach to designing interactive and visually appealing dashboards. By applying the strategies outlined in this blog, you can create data visualizations that not only convey information effectively but also engage and inform your audience. Whether you’re visualizing sales trends, customer demographics, or financial performance, Tableau provides the tools to make your data come to life.

With practice and experimentation, you’ll be able to leverage Tableau’s full potential and make data visualization an integral part of your analytical toolkit.